WATCH: Pence rebukesTrump, ‘crackpotlawyers’ over Jan. 6

Former Vice President Mike Pence said Donald Trump should not be up for the White House again, given his efforts to overturn the 2020 election. Pence was responding to questions from the media during a news briefing on Wednesday — a day after the DOJ announced an indictment based on the Jan. 6 investigation.

Pence recounted how Trump had asked him to reject electoral votes from states that had narrowly voted for President Joe Biden in the 2020 election. Pence said he refused this argument as unconstitutional, but despite this, Trump has continued to claim his former vice president had the power to overturn the election results. Pence said these efforts were disqualifying for someone to be president of the United States.

“Anyone who puts themselves over the Constitution should never be president of the United States. And anyone who asks someone else to put themselves over the Constitution should be president of the United States again,” Pence said.

Pence said Trump had been convinced he could change the result of the election by a group of “crackpot lawyers.”

“Sadly, the president was surrounded by a group of crackpot lawyers who kept telling him what his itching ears wanted to hear,” Pence said.
